Publisher's Summary
Maria Magdalene er en af Jesu trofaste disciple og ifølge Det nye Testamente den første, som den opstandne Jesus viser sig for. I "Mariaevangeliet" fremstår hun som en ledende discipel, der fortæller om den åbenbaring, hun har fra Jesus selv. "Mariaevangeliet" er ikke bevaret i sin helhed, men giver alligevel et indblik i kirkens ældste historie. En tid præget af konflikter om den sande og rette lære og om hvem, der havde autoritet til at bringe den videre ud i verden.
"Mariaevangeliet" blev fundet i 1896 og udgivet første gang i 1955. Det er nyoversat fra koptisk af Marianne Aagaard Skovmand, som skriver en grundig introduktion til skriftet og reflekterer over dets betydning.
